Acupuncture, a key component of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M), has been practiced for thousands of years. It involves the insertion of very thin needles into specific points on the body to balance the flow of energy or life force—known as qi (chi). Principles and Benefits of Acupuncture
Before we delve into the benefits, it’s essential to understand the foundational principles of acupressure. In TCM, it is believed that health results from a harmonious balance between the yin and yang of the life force. This life force flows through pathways in your body called meridians. Any obstruction in these pathways can lead to illness or pain.
Acupuncture aims to restore the flow of qi, thus promoting health and healing. Here are the notable benefits of Acupuncture:
1- Pain Relief
One of the most significant benefits of acupressure is its ability to reduce chronic pain, including:
– Lower back pain
– Neck pain
– Osteoarthritis/knee pain
– Headaches and migraines
Acupuncture stimulates points on or under the skin, releasing natural painkillers, like endorphins, and stimulating nerve and muscle tissue, which is thought to help relieve pain.

Integration of Acupuncture with Other Traditional Chinese Medicine Practices
Acupuncture is not a stand-alone remedy in Chinese Medicine. Instead, it is often combined with various practices that form a cohesive and integrated therapeutic system. This approach to healing is akin to different instruments playing together in a symphony, each contributing to the overall performance by enhancing the effectiveness of others.
When you visit a practitioner for an acupressure session, you may also be introduced to complementary techniques like herbal medicine, where natural concoctions designed to balance your body’s energy are prescribed.
Additionally, you might partake in dietary therapy, receiving guidance on food choices that promote internal equilibrium according to your individual constitution and health condition.
Other techniques like cupping, which involves placing cups on the skin to create suction, and tuina massage – a form of Chinese therapeutic massage, may also enhance the benefits of acupressure. Qi gong and tai chi, which are movement-based exercises that cultivate the flow of qi (vital energy) within the body, can be recommended as part of a holistic treatment plan, too. Emphasis on Treating the Root Cause of Health Issues
An important principle underpinning acupressure is the pursuit of identifying and addressing the underlying issues, the roots, that give rise to health problems rather than merely providing short-term fixes for symptoms.
In Western medicine, you might find that a headache is commonly treated with painkillers, targeting the discomfort. In contrast, a Chinese Medicine practitioner will seek to comprehend the deeper reasons for your headache, which could be related to stress, hormonal imbalances, nutritional deficiencies, or the blockage of energy pathways, among other factors.
Acupuncture is based on the belief that health is governed by the flow of qi through a network of pathways in the body known as meridians. Disruptions or imbalances in the flow of qi can lead to illness. By inserting fine needles into specific points along these meridians, acupressure aims to restore balance, not just masking symptoms but promoting long-term health and vitality.
For instance, if digestive issues are the concern, rather than simply quelling the symptoms, acupressure would work to strengthen the digestive system’s intrinsic function. The practitioner may identify the meridian points that correlate with the digestive system and focus the treatment on these areas to reforge balance and capacity within the system.
